
River Cruise Digoin / Saint-Satur / Digoin
Crisboat - Expert in river boat rental for over 20 years
Digoin - Saint-Satur - Digoin - 310 Km - 62 Locks - 54 h of navigation - 14 Nights (2 weeks)
From Digoin to Pierrefitte, 15 km, 3 Lock(s), 2.6 h of navigation

the Canal Bridge of Digoin
This aqueduct allows the Loire river to be crossed; at 235m in length it is smaller than the one in Briare.the trim of Canalou (perch, pike, salmon, eel with red wine sauce)

La Charité-sur-Loire
Upon arrival, the stone bridge sets the tone for this village's past; it is one of only two original bridges on the Loire. Also designated a 'city of books', La Charité-sur-Loire is known above all for the Basilica of Sainte-Croix, which was one of the largest religious buildings in France, before various wars partially destroyed the landmark.From La Charité sur Loire to St Satur, 22 km, 4 Lock(s), 3.7 h of navigation

Sancerre
This town revolves around wine. In the town century you can find the Sancerre Dovetail, which brings together a number of wine-growers from the region and offers a guided tour and a tasting of the best Sancerre has to offer.
